Battlefield 6 Season 1 Arrives October 28 as Reports Signal Battle Royale Shadowdrop

EA has not confirmed the mode’s name, date or pricing despite developer notes detailing pre‑launch tweaks, with Battlefield Labs paused.

Overview

  • Update 1.1.1.0 is scheduled for 09:00 UTC on October 28, with Season 1 content going live at 15:00 UTC across all platforms.
  • Dataminers point to a separate content drop codenamed Granite, reported for October 28 and widely linked to the battle royale, with leakers citing a free‑to‑play release titled Battlefield: RedSec.
  • Battlefield Studios outlined pre‑launch battle royale adjustments from Labs testing, including close‑range time‑to‑kill tuning, two‑plate armor capacity, lighting and visibility fixes, and helicopter and vehicle balance changes.
  • Developers say performance work for the battle royale has progressed based on playtests, and Battlefield Labs is on hiatus to prioritize the Season 1 rollout.
  • Beyond the unannounced mode, the October 28 patch targets weapon dispersion behavior, animation and vaulting improvements, exposure and brightness tuning, and broader matchmaking and progression fixes.
